Variétés is a collection of pictures taken between the 1920s and the 1970s featuring artists and popular spectacles not always within the law. A tour around the aesthetic of this very particular form of looking at variety shows in Spain. A journey through the faces and the attitudes of a world
which actually shone much less than the photographs sought to show. Variétés is the history of the ephemeral flash and the failure which are inherent to this form of understanding the spectacle. Moreover, it is a tribute to so many people who belonged to a world which is on the way to
extinction and where the illusion and the magic of the night
claimed to have such a fleeting but beautiful power.
